Latest Patents

Iwanami holds a patent for a supercharger and method for connecting pipes in a supercharger. This invention includes a housing, a rotary shaft, and a compressor wheel, among other components. The design features a cooling water supplying pipe and a cooling water discharging pipe, both equipped with flange parts for secure connection to the housing. Additionally, a lubricant supplying pipe is integrated into the system, enhancing the functionality of the supercharger.

Career Highlights

Seiichi Iwanami is currently employed at Mitsubishi Heavy Industries Engine & Turbocharger, Ltd. His work at this esteemed company has allowed him to focus on developing cutting-edge technologies in the field of turbocharging and supercharging systems.
